How much should a kitchen backsplash cost?

The average cost for kitchen backsplash is roughly $400 to $600 per 16 square foot, excluding labor. You could pay about $300 to $400 per 16 square foot for cheaper ceramic variations, or between $650 and $1,000 Glenview kitchen remodeling per 16 square foot for high-quality types.

Porcelain and ceramic floor tile is a prominent kitchen floor covering selection that is reasonably valued ($ 5-7 per square foot). Mounting hardwood or natural stone tile runs on the expensive side ($ 8-10+ per square foot). Products such as engineered wood, plastic plank and also linoleum floor covering are a whole lot more spending plan pleasant (under $5 per square foot). Why is backsplash so expensive?

A high-quality tile costs more than average because it's made from expensive materials, looks better, and often offers better durability and easier maintenance. Always factor in the cost of contractor labor and shipping before selecting tile for your kitchen or bathroom renovation.
